On Fri, Jan 26, 2018 at 2:37 AM, Michal Hocko <mhocko@suse.com> wrote:
> On Tue 16-01-18 16:30:08, Jerome Glisse wrote:
>> I want to talk about status of HMM and respective upstream user for
>> it and also talk about what's next in term of features/improvement
>> plan (generic page write protection, mmu_notifier, ...). Most likely
>> short 15-30minutes if mmu_notifier is split into its own topic.
>>
>> I want to talk about mmu_notifier, specificaly adding more context
>> information to mmu_notifier callback (why a notification is happening
>> reclaim, munmap, migrate, ...). Maybe we can grow this into its own
>> topic and talk about mmu_notifier and issue with it like OOM or being
>> able to sleep/take lock ... and improving mitigation.
